The Ribeira da Mo is located in Briteiros, in the municipality of Guimarães, integrated within a context that reconciles the urban environment with more natural extensions. Its position allows a link between built-up areas and green spaces, providing an opportunity to enjoy nature even in the vicinity of the residential zone.
This watercourse is a crucial element in the local landscape, distinguished by its recovered environmental quality. As a result of investment in the valorization of the riparian ecosystem, its banks have been restored and the water quality improved. Along its course, the stream offers a serene panorama, where native vegetation contributes to a tranquil environment, inviting moments of rest and observation.
The Ribeira da Mo constitutes an accessible and pleasant place for visitors, designed to promote interaction with the environment. Beyond its scenic appeal, this stream plays a crucial ecological role in water cycle management and natural biological purification. It represents an example of how urban requalification can converge with environmental conservation, creating a valuable public space for the community and visitors.
